Transaction 660859b688cb02c83a8221971dc158e43f049815913ab0359b54ad8841eda73c
1 Input
1 Output
-
660859b688cb02c83a8221971dc158e43f049815913ab0359b54ad8841eda73c:0
- value
- 786944
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0da61101f1ac4716cf4b71438885a40d602364b0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12FAizYF7oxnmYDN51iyCbiR8zKAvfAL3V